**Mgmt Meeting Minutes — Retiring the Brightline Range**

Quick recap for sales leads at Fenholt Supplies: we agreed to retire the Brightline fixture range by year-end. Remaining stock moves to clearance pricing next month, and accounts on standing orders get migrated to the Lumetta range. Trade-in incentives were approved in principle. The confidential note on next steps sits just below.

board note of bajof-bajeg: The pricing group signed off on a budget of $13.4 million for Project Sildor. The renewal with Lamixek Holdings closes at $48.9 million a year, 49 percent above the last contract.

Weekly cash-box run — Varnholt branch receiving. Confirm the sealed box arrives before 10:00 Tuesday. Check seal number against the manifest from Delkerton Ops. Do not open until a second staffer is present. Log weight on the intake sheet, initial both copies, and lock the box in the counting room safe immediately. Any seal damage: refuse and call Delkerton Ops at once. The courier hand-over instruction follows below.

handover note for yagef-bagep: the drudor pelius courier leaves the kasdor zorvan norir ledger at gate 8016 under passcode 755406

Subject: Ownership transfer — thumbnail generation queue

Hello,

As part of the Brimvale platform reorganization, responsibility for the thumbnail generation queue is moving out of the Media Tools group effective next sprint. Please update the release runbook, paging rotation, and approval matrix accordingly, and route all deploy sign-offs to the new owner. The incoming responsible party is named below.

account owner for bawip-tahag: Raleth Quenok